Ms. Janie L. Tyson, 76, a resident of Bethel, passed away Monday, April 9, 2012, following a short illness.

A birthday and memorial celebration will be held today from 3 p.m. until 5 p.m. at her home.

Janie L. Tyson

Ms. Tyson was a Greene County native having grown up in a farming family. She had been a longtime resident of Pitt County where she was a graduate of Stokes High School and played basketball. She had been a longtime member of Greenville Church of Christ.

A creative person by nature, Janie was an accomplished “how to” success. She completed an entire renovation of her family’s home place and it later became a featured story in the Daily Reflector. She enjoyed spending time at the river fishing and also enjoyed gardening.

Janie will be most fondly remembered by her family for her unconditional love and care she gave her children and family. A loving mother, sister, grandmother, great-grandmother and friend, Janie will be sorely missed by the many who loved her.

In addition to her parents, she was preceded in death by four brothers, Bobby, Gordon, Carson and J.W. Tyson.
